The cheapest way to get from Indra Square Pratunam to Damnoen Saduak Floating Market is to bus which costs ฿95 - ฿105 and takes 3h 31m.
The fastest way to get from Indra Square Pratunam to Damnoen Saduak Floating Market is to drive which takes 1h 29m and costs ฿310 - ฿460.
No, there is no direct bus from Indra Square Pratunam to Damnoen Saduak Floating Market. However, there are services departing from อินทราสแควร์ประตูน้ำ;Indra Square Pratunam and arriving at Damnoen Saduak via อนุสาวรีย์ชัยสมรภูมิ and Southern Bus Terminal Bangkok. The journey, including transfers, takes approximately 3h 21m.
The distance between Indra Square Pratunam and Damnoen Saduak Floating Market is 84 km. The road distance is 85.1 km.
The best way to get from Indra Square Pratunam to Damnoen Saduak Floating Market without a car is to train and taxi which takes 2h 50m and costs ฿470 - ฿1600.
It takes approximately 2h 50m to get from Indra Square Pratunam to Damnoen Saduak Floating Market, including transfers.

Local Bus Thailand operates a bus from Southern Bus Terminal Bangkok to Damnoen Saduak hourly. Tickets cost ฿80 and the journey takes 2h.
